holes drilled in the clutch basket fingers is to allow more oil into the clutch discs,
not to lighten it
supposedly helps the clutch discs last longer ????

personally i wouldn't risk catastrophic failure of a clutch basket
when new tusk clutch discs can be had for under $30

aftermarket clutch baskets come with the holes pre-drilled
 
I considered this mod but came to the same conclusion as awk and backed out.Clutches are cheaper than the damage that could happen if it let go.
